Grilled New Potatoes
Makes 4 servings
Ingredients:
2 pounds new red potatoes
1/4 cup butter, melted
2 cloves garlic, crushed
1 tablespoon seasoned salt
Directions:
- Preheat grill to medium heat. Place potatoes in a foil pan or on heavy-duty aluminum foil. Mix together butter, garlic, and salt and pour over potatoes. Cover pan with foil or form a packet with foil.
- Place potatoes on grill and cook 50 to 60 minutes or until potatoes are form tender. Potatoes can also be baked in a 400 degree F. oven for 50 to 60 minutes.
The Ultimate Burger
Makes 4 servings
Ingredients:
1 1/2 pounds ground sirloin
Sea salt, to taste
Ground pepper, to taste
1 sprig fresh rosemary, only leaves
1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
2 large Vidalia or WallaWalla onions, cut into thick slices
1/3 pound Jarlsberg or Jarlsberg lite cheese slices
2 large vine-ripened tomatoes, cut into thick slices
4 large lettuce leaves
Tangy barbeque sauce
4 whole grain hamburger buns
Directions:
- Preheat grill to medium heat. Form meat into 4 patties and sprinkle with salt and pepper. Combine rosemary leaves with oil and brush onto onions. Sprinkle with salt and pepper.
- Grill onions 2 minutes per side until they are tender and golden. Grill meat 4 to 6 minutes per side or until preferred degree of doneness. When they are almost done, place cheese slices on top and let melt.
- Coat rolls with the rest of the rosemary oil and grill until toasted. Place burgers on buns, top with barbecue sauce, onion slices, lettuce, and tomato.
Grilled Herbed Vegetables
Makes 4 servings
Ingredients:
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 clove garlic, minced
2 teaspoons snipped fresh rosemary or 2 tablespoon snipped Fresh basil leaves
1/4 teaspoon salt
4 cups mixed vegetables, such as eggplant, summer squash or zucchini, green beans, red onion, and red, green, or yellow sweet peppers
Directions:
- Preheat grill to medium heat. Combine oil with garlic, rosemary, and salt. Toss vegetables with oil.
- Transfer vegetables to a large piece of aluminum foil and seal to form a packet, leaving a part open to steam. Grill vegetables for 20 minutes or until fork tender. Alternatively, packets can also be baked in a 350 degree F. oven for 25 minutes.
Barbecued S'mores Wraps
Makes 4 servings
Ingredients:
4 large flour tortillas
1 cup milk chocolate chips
2 cups miniature marshmallows
Fillings:
Pie filling (any flavor)
Butterscotch chips
Peanut butter chips
White chocolate chips
Caramel sauce
Hot fudge
Candied fruit
Directions:
- Preheat grill to medium heat. Place each tortilla on a large piece of aluminum foil. Top each tortilla with chocolate chips, marshmallows, and fillings of your choice.
- Roll tortillas like a burrito and wrap in foil. Grill for 3 to 5 minutes, turning to heat all sides and evenly melt ingredients.
